The number average molecular weight (Mn) relates to the number average degree of polymerization (DPn) and the molecular weight of the repeating unit (M0).
The calculation uses the formula:
$ M_n = DP_n \times M_0 $
The molecular weight of the styrene unit ($M_0$) is calculated using standard atomic weights (C $\approx 12.011$ g/mol, H $\approx 1.008$ g/mol):
$ M_0 = (8 \times 12.011) + (8 \times 1.008) \approx 104.15 \text{ g/mol} $
Substituting the values:
$ M_n = 1000 \times 104.15 \text{ g/mol} \approx 104150 \text{ g/mol} $
This calculated value is approximately $1.04 \times 10^5$ g/mol.
